Document Description
Rental agreements for residential property are governed by the South Carolina Residential Landlord & Tenant Act. If a landlord wishes to file an eviction action against a residential tenant for non-payment of rent, the act requires a 5 Day Notice before such an action can commence.
Who: This notice is given to a tenant who fails or refuses to pay rent when due.
What: Unless otherwise specified within the lease; this notice is required prior to filing for an eviction.
When: Give this notice to your tenant(s) 5 days before filing for eviction.
